Isham Park: Inwood Pumpkin Pageant

The Inwood Pumpkin Pageant will return to beautiful Isham Park, for its 11th edition. Bring your carved jack-o-lantern to the park the night after Halloween and we will light them up for a family-friendly community display. Vote for your favorite designs to see if they will win the coveted Blue Ribbon! For older kids, pumpkin smashing starts at 7:30 pm as we prepare the rotting gourds for composting, keeping them out of the landfills.

Fort Tryon Park: Halloween Haunted Cottage

Trick or treat at the historic Fort Tryon Park Cottage and discover a Halloween celebration like no other!

Families and neighbors are invited to explore the haunted grounds of this landmark building, where spooky decorations and festive photo spots will bring the holiday to life. Take pictures and enjoy the fun of seeing the cottage transformed into a haunted house for one night only.

The Haunted Cottage will take place at 741 Fort Washington Avenue, on the corner of Margaret Corbin Circle.
